96 James Halliday's Australian Wine Companion -
Hand-picked, whole berries and whole bunches small batch open-fermented, larger concrete fermenters at the original winery also included for extended maceration on skins for 2 weeks, matured for 19 months in French oak (27% new). Both bouquet and medium-bodied palate offer a tapestry of black fruits, spices and black pepper, tannins woven through the succulent, juicy black fruits, French oak there or thereabouts, and fine lingering tannins.
92 Vinous -
(30 percent new French oak) Bright violet. Potent, mineral-accented dark berry, cola and licorice scents are complemented by hints of allspice, mocha and candied flowers. Fleshy and appealingly sweet, offering concentrated cassis, cherry-vanilla and violet pastille flavors that are underscored by a vein of smoky minerality. Displays excellent depth and energy and shows impressive focus on the long, sweet finish, which is framed by smooth, harmonious tannins.

About the Producer

With imposing, rugged cliff faces casting shadows across ancient vine plantings, Mount Langi Ghiran is set against the dramatic backdrop of the Great Dividing Range in the Grampians region of Victoria. The Mount Langi Ghiran (Aboriginal for home of the yellow-tailed black cockatoo) vineyard is one of the most isolated and unique sites in Australian viticulture.
